于时代洪荒中的一些程序思考

作者:嵌入式历练者

ID : Eterlove

记下相关笔记,记录我的学习生活!站在巨人的肩上Standing on Shoulders of Giants!

该文章为原创,转载请注明出处和作者:https://blog.csdn.net/Eterlove/article/details/120750267

----------------------------------对编程的思考和见解
         我始终认为“万丈高楼平地起”,一定重视自己的基础编程能力和独立解决问题的能力。而且“基础”不是简单的谈谈,你不能简单认为学会了一门编程语言的基础语法,就认为掌握这门语言,那还早了点!
        底层基础能力也不是天天叫你练习什么水仙花题,说什么我要练基础,基础是在自己实践项目中实际出来的技巧和深刻理解,你要不断地向上学习,向上爬,扩展自己的见识和知识面,这个时候最关键的来了,然后你要往下看,静下心分析自己的不足,进而打磨你的底层能力,如此反复循环。

        人们常说修高楼要打下坚实基础,才能修的更高,但是房子基础不牢就只能重新修,但对我们人来说,这一点具有动态调整性,我们可以不断往上爬,然后不断的回头打牢自己的基础,但你一定要有这个意识,这一点很重要!
        程序员也可以写出像诗一样的代码,但我们不可能一开始就写出优雅的代码,这对我们的起点要求太高了,也不现实。一般来说,第一阶段,我们应该围绕需求尽快的写出能够实现功能的代码,管你简单还是复杂,能实现功能的就是好代码!!!第二阶段,我们要从代码的结构和维护出发,重构代码是一个非常重要的思想,通过功能模板化来整理和重构你的代码,使其更具有健壮性,从而写出简单而又易于维护的好代码。在实现功能的条件下,不要认为复杂的代码比简单的代码要好,你那是耍酷!因为你的同事可能因你的代码而苦恼不已!
        写代码只是一会的事情,而维护代码才是一段时间乃至长期的工作,我希望你考虑好这一点,当然,有的人停在了第一阶段,而有的停在了第二阶段,甚至有人连第一阶段的门都没迈进去!那可真让人感到头痛的事情------且看你自己的追求吧!

        这篇文章是写给我自己的,在程序的时代洪荒中磨砺自己,历练自己!

准备出发了,历练者!

评论 8
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

嵌入式历练者

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值